Transaction 76e202ee606d97d753bc36f61d4f6842f0aa8a71aa95cd3e1cd98032fca920c5

1 Input
2 Outputs
  • 76e202ee606d97d753bc36f61d4f6842f0aa8a71aa95cd3e1cd98032fca920c5:0
  • value  2571473
    address  16hTvpYPoZLaabQYYaXp2CHpKojS5Xt8wh
  • 76e202ee606d97d753bc36f61d4f6842f0aa8a71aa95cd3e1cd98032fca920c5:1
  • value  21651161
    address  1AGSTDnSZoTNmzK78ue29Azoq6JexmKGwD